Fairfax and Peirce Nominated to SEC

President Obama selected Democrat Lisa Fairfax and Republican Hester Peirce to serve on the SEC. Fairfax, a law professor at George Washington University, surfaced after liberal groups pressured the White House not to hire a corporate lawyer who had previously worked to represent Wall Street.
